Kas yra naudojimo atvejų asociacijos diagrama?
Kas yra naudojimo atvejų asociacijos diagrama?

Video: Kas yra naudojimo atvejų asociacijos diagrama?

Video: Kas yra naudojimo atvejų asociacijos diagrama?
Video: UML Use Case Diagram Tutorial 2024, Lapkritis
Anonim

asociacija . An asociacija yra aktoriaus ir verslo santykiai naudojimo atvejis . Tai rodo, kad aktorius gali naudoti tam tikras verslo sistemos – verslo – funkcionalumas naudojimo atvejis : Deja, asociacija nepateikia jokios informacijos apie tai, kaip funkcionalumas naudojamas.

Taip pat reikia žinoti, kas yra apibendrinimas naudojimo atvejų diagramoje?

Kontekste naudojimo atvejis modeliuojant naudojimo atvejų apibendrinimas reiškia ryšį, kuris gali egzistuoti tarp dviejų naudojimo atvejai ir kuris rodo tą vieną naudojimo atvejis (vaikas) paveldi kito veikėjo (tėvo) struktūrą, elgesį ir santykius.

Taip pat galima paklausti, į kokius reikalavimus atsižvelgiama naudojimo atvejų diagramoje? Piešimo metu reikia laikytis šių taisyklių naudoti - atveju bet kuriai sistemai: veikėjo vardas arba a naudojimo atvejis turi būti prasmingi ir susiję su sistema. Aktoriaus sąveika su naudojimo atvejis turi būti aiškiai ir suprantamai apibrėžti. Komentarai turi būti naudojami visur, kur jų reikia.

Be to, kas yra nukreipta asociacija naudojimo atvejų diagramoje?

UML modeliuose nukreipti asociacijos ryšiai yra asociacijos, kurias galima naršyti tik viena kryptimi. Nukreipta asociacija rodo, kad kontrolė kyla iš vieno klasifikatorius kitam; pavyzdžiui, aktorius į naudojimo atvejį. Šis valdymo srautas reiškia, kad tik vienas iš susiejimo galų nurodo navigaciją.

Kas yra naudojimo atvejų išplėtimo diagrama?

UML Use Case Extend Extend yra nukreiptas ryšys, nurodantis, kaip ir kada elgsena apibrėžiama paprastai papildomame (neprivaloma) naudojimo atvejo pratęsimas gali būti įtrauktas į elgseną, apibrėžtą išplėstinio naudojimo atvejis . Išplėsto naudojimo atvejis yra prasmingas pats savaime, jis nepriklauso nuo naudojimo atvejo pratęsimas.

Rekomenduojamas: